Roddy Doyle
Adapted from Roddy Doyle's 1990 novel of the same name.
Northside Dublin, late 1980s.
A Gate Studio commission.
The Snapper is an account of the ups and downs of family life and pregnancy in Northside Dublin of the late 1980s.
